Château de Labastide-Paumès is a historic castle located in the commune of Labastide-Paumès in the Haute-Garonne department of France.
The castle dates back partly to the 9th century, with its main building constructed around 1164. It features a large tower with a spiral staircase added about a century later.
The castle is privately owned and has been officially listed as a historic monument by the French Ministry of Culture since 1927. It stands as an important architectural and historical landmark in the region, showcasing medieval construction styles and fortification elements.
The castle's history reflects its role in the feudal and rural development of southwestern France.
